Planeswalkers in the World of Magic: The Gathering (万智牌世界中的鹏洛客们) is a Chinese-exclusive release of a planeswalker-themed set of stamps. It was released as part of the events celebrating the 30th anniversary of Magic: The Gathering in December, 2022.

Description

The set of stamps was released in a collaboration with China Post in a limited print run. The stamps came in an luxe illustrated album.

Players could win a copy by writing a postcard to Wizards of the Coast China.[1][2] It also was a bonus for spending over CNY 900 (ca. $125 USD) when buying The Brothers' War boosters.[3]

The album measures 11.5 inches x 8 3/4 inches. It has a hard glossy coated cardboard slip case, that has artwork matching the front and back of the book. The "pages" of the book are like a board book, they're thick cardboard and have gold on the outside facing edges. The front cover features a red-colored planeswalker symbol in the setting of Dominaria's united forces. The first page has a China Post postcard, which is held in with a clear acetate type material, it folds inwards to hold the postcard in place. The front of the postcard features a combination of the artworks from the front/back of the book. The second page has the Magic 30 logo, with some motifs, the Chain Veil, etc. Page 3 is Urza with the Mightstone, this artwork is the same as the The Brothers' War booster box artwork. Page 4 has the first batch of stamps, again held in place by an acetate type film. Page 5 is Mishra with the Weakstone from the booster box artwork. Page 6 is the last page of the book with the remainder of the stamps. The back cover is a green-colored planeswalker symbol in the setting of New Phyrexia's poisonous forces.[4]

The stamps respectively depict Urza, Mishra, Liliana Vess, Karn, Chandra Nalaar, Ajani Goldmane, Sorin, Jace Beleren, Teferi Akosa, Ugin, Nissa Revane and Kaya Cassir.
